## Deploying the Gatewick Proctor Queue

Deploys are pretty painless: push to main, wait for the pipeline, then watch the queue drain dashboard for five minutes. If candidates pile up mid-exam, roll back first and ask questions later — the queue replays safely. Everything the workers care about lives in one config block, shown here for reference.

settings of bafof-yagef:
JOROX_PIN=8740
JOROX_TENANT=pelox
JOROX_METRICS_HOST=metrics.jorox.qorvelworks.internal
JOROX_SEAL=seal_c78f63c1
JOROX_STANDBY_TEAM=norax

## Break-Glass: Retrying Failed Exports

If the Lanternfall export queue stalls and normal operator access fails, use break-glass mode on the Quillbridge console. Drain stuck jobs with `export-retry --force`, then re-enable the scheduler. Break-glass sessions auto-expire after 30 minutes and are logged to the Marrowgate audit bucket. Do not reuse sessions across incidents. To unlock the break-glass console, you will need the recovery passphrase below.

vault phrase of kawep-tahog = ulaix-briath

**Mgmt Meeting Minutes — Retiring the Brightline Range**

Quick recap for sales leads at Fenholt Supplies: we agreed to retire the Brightline fixture range by year-end. Remaining stock moves to clearance pricing next month, and accounts on standing orders get migrated to the Lumetta range. Trade-in incentives were approved in principle. The confidential note on next steps sits just below.

board note of bajof-bajeg: The pricing group signed off on a budget of $13.4 million for Project Sildor. The renewal with Lamixek Holdings closes at $48.9 million a year, 49 percent above the last contract.